Assistant Curator, NAGPRA (Fixed-Term)

Fine Arts Museums of San Francisco 

San Francisco, California

 

Under the supervision of the Curator in Charge, Arts of Africa, Oceania, and the Americas (AOA) and Curator, Arts of the Americas, and in close collaboration with Registration staff, the Fixed-Term Assistant Curator, Native American Graves Protection and Repatriation Act (NAGPRA), will assist the Fine Arts Museums of San Francisco (FAMSF) with documentation and consultation to comply with CalNAGPRA and the Federal NAGPRA. This position is for a fixed-term of 2 years.

As directed, complete object records for FAMSF collections subject to CalNAGPRA and NAGPRA. Compile object name, artist information (if applicable), place of creation, provenance, tribal affiliation or cultural affiliation, exhibition and publication history, materials and technique. Deliverables include a TMS record and research files including data sheets for each item (as applicable). Information might include archival and library research findings, transcribed interviews with artists and community members, oral histories, Federal Register research, consultation with CalNAGPRA and NAGPRA program staff, etc.
